ADAU1777BCBZRL Details

  • Manufacturer Part Number:

    ADAU1777BCBZRL

  • Brand Name:

    Analog Devices Inc

  • Pbfree Code:

    No

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Package Description:

    WLCSP-36

  • Pin Count:

    36

  • Manufacturer Package Code:

    CB-36-4

  • Country Of Origin:

    Malaysia

  • ECCN Code:

    EAR99

  • HTS Code:

    8542.39.00.01

  • Manufacturer:

    Analog Devices Inc

  • YTEOL:

    9

  • Consumer IC Type:

    CONSUMER CIRCUIT

  • JESD-30 Code:

    R-PBGA-B36

  • JESD-609 Code:

    e1

  • Length:

    3.765 mm

  • Moisture Sensitivity Level:

    1

  • Number of Functions:

    1

  • Number of Terminals:

    36

  • Operating Temperature-Max:

    85 °C

  • Operating Temperature-Min:

    -40 °C

  • Package Body Material:

    PLASTIC/EPOXY

  • Package Code:

    VFBGA

  • Package Shape:

    RECTANGULAR

  • Package Style:

    GRID ARRAY, VERY THIN PROFILE, FINE PITCH

  • Peak Reflow Temperature (Cel):

    260

  • Seated Height-Max:

    0.66 mm

  • Supply Voltage-Max (Vsup):

    3.63 V

  • Supply Voltage-Min (Vsup):

    1.71 V

  • Surface Mount:

    YES

  • Temperature Grade:

    INDUSTRIAL

  • Terminal Finish:

    Tin/Silver/Copper (Sn/Ag/Cu)

  • Terminal Form:

    BALL

  • Terminal Pitch:

    0.5 mm

  • Terminal Position:

    BOTTOM

  • Time@Peak Reflow Temperature-Max (s):

    30

  • Width:

    3.195 mm

About Analog Devices

Analog Devices Inc. is a global leader in the design and manufacturing of analog, mixed-signal, and digital signal processing integrated circuits and software solutions for the industrial, automotive, healthcare, communications industries. Analog Devices serves a diverse range of markets including industrial, automotive, healthcare, energy, aerospace, defense, and consumer electronics industries. Analog Devices’ product portfolio includes a wide range of ICs, modules, and subsystems.
